💡 Growing Tips for Avocado
Grafted trees fruit much sooner. Needs well-drained soil. Wait until soil warms to at least 18°C before transplanting outdoors — cold soil stunts growth and can invite root rot. Aim for about 2.5 cm of water per week, adjusting for rainfall. Organic mulch around the base helps maintain even moisture.

Douala, CM is in USDA Hardiness Zone 13 with a Tropical monsoon climate (Köppen Am). With winter lows of 22°C and summer highs of 32°C, the growing season spans approximately 365 frost-free days. Avocado requires more experience to grow successfully in this climate.
Avocado thrives in temperatures between 18°C and 28°C, requiring full sun and regular watering. In Douala, the best months to plant Avocado are January, February, March, April, May, June, July, August, September, October, November, December. Avocado is not frost tolerant, so it's important to wait until after the last spring frost before transplanting outdoors. Expect to harvest in approximately 1095-1825 days after planting.
Douala receives 3848mm of annual rainfall, which provides good natural moisture for Avocado. Supplement with additional watering during dry spells.
